Bob Mortimer’s Career and Partnership with Paul Whitehouse

Bob Mortimer and Paul Whitehouse are two British comedy legends who have forged a unique friendship over the years. Their BBC show Mortimer & Whitehouse: Gone Fishing combines humor with serene moments by the riverside, offering viewers a glimpse into the personal lives of these two men as they reflect on health, aging, and life. The show first aired in 2018, and its popularity has grown steadily, becoming a hit with fans who enjoy both the fishing and the deep, often philosophical conversations.

Gone Fishing: A Heartfelt and Humorous Journey
The concept of Gone Fishing emerged after Mortimer underwent heart surgery in 2015, a life-altering event that changed his perspective on health and well-being. Paul Whitehouse, who has also had his share of health struggles, suggested fishing as a way to relax and reflect. What started as a simple idea soon blossomed into one of the most charming and heartwarming shows on British television.

Bob Mortimer’s Health Challenges – From Heart Surgery to Shingles

Bob Mortimer has faced numerous health challenges throughout his life. In 2015, he underwent triple heart bypass surgery, a turning point that not only saved his life but also inspired Gone Fishing. In 2024, Mortimer’s health was in the spotlight again when he revealed he had shingles, a painful condition that affected his mobility while filming the latest season of Gone Fishing.

Despite these setbacks, Mortimer continues to push forward, embodying resilience and determination. His openness about his health struggles has also inspired many fans who face similar challenges, showing that humor can help in even the toughest times.
